Rather than help each other to feel more calm and secure, people tend to sense another persons stress, feel stressed themselves, and then react in ways that cascade both people in the interaction into more stress. Whitney Goodman, LMFT, author of Toxic Positivity, says that healthy complaining tends to be: On the other hand, Goodman shares, unhealthy complaining tends to: If complaining is healthy then youll notice that it tends to be helpful because the person complaining will find a solution, feel relieved, or feel connected to you after talking.
